40 minutes ago, dopper99 said:

Do I assume with the 1941 update, you can set it going then get out and lock the car and it will carry on till its done? I cant imagine you have to stay in the car the whole time?

The previous owner of my car never updated it. Since i've owned it, it's done about 3 ota updates. (Also 2 done in the shop and still not faultless 🤦)

Once the update is downloaded and you start it, you can leave the car, lock it... The update will complete on it's own.

 

Also, as noticed by others, every major update has been followed immediately by a smaller one, wich completes in a few seconds. So that seems normal.

15 minutes ago, Booth11 said:


I could be wrong (and mine was done at dealership) but doesn’t it download in the background as your either driving or if not driving, with the car ignition on (and maybe hooked up to a battery charger as a precaution)  and then to install the download you exit and lock the car and leave it to install?  
 

Mine had a series of small updates immediately after the big 1941 update as mentioned by @-kenny-

Yes. In my experience, and i believe this is in the disclaimer when you start the download too, the download itself pauses when you interrupt it by turning the ignition off. But it resumes when you turn the iginition back on.

Once the install itself starts, the car is not useable anyway. It continues untill it's complete.

2 hours ago, AHG said:

@mahalo

I’d wait a few more days before doing a hard reset

just my opinion


My first (small) update got stuck a couple of times, and each time it persisted for a while and wouldn’t let me do it again until a few days had past, when it would “give up” on the attempt and ask me if to download as if it never tried before.

 

If that happens to you, I suggest going to settings and tethering to your phone via WiFi (instead of eSim) before engaging the download.

Your phone probably has a stronger, faster and more stable connection.
